Jon's Current Read

Waterbrooke Phase 3 is a newer build-out in Clermont, with homes delivered between 2019 and 2024 and a median build year of 2022. That tight age band matters: what separates one asking price from the next here is less about vintage and more about condition, upgrades carried over from the builder, lot position, and finish level. The median home runs just under 2,000 square feet, so the product is fairly consistent, and price spread tends to follow how a specific home shows rather than dramatic differences in size or era.

The snapshot shows no closings in the current window, which means we are working from limited recent transaction signal rather than a hot, high-velocity trend. For a buyer, that argues for patience and leaning on comparable finishes rather than assuming momentum in either direction. For a seller, it means pricing to condition and being realistic — a thin recent record puts more weight on how sharply your home presents against the newer inventory nearby.

A newer section that trades on condition

With every home built in a narrow 2019–2024 window and a median square footage near 1,981, Waterbrooke Phase 3 is about as uniform as newer product gets. That uniformity is useful when you evaluate a home: the questions that move value are upgrade level, lot, orientation, and how well the owner has maintained a house that is still only a few years old. Don't expect a wide age-driven price ladder here; expect condition-driven separation.

The homestead share — roughly 64.5 percent — points to a section that is largely owner-occupied rather than dominated by short holds. In a community this new, that is worth noting, because owner-occupied stock generally shows better and turns over more deliberately. Combined with a quiet recent closing window, it reinforces the case for judging each listing on its own merits instead of a fast-moving comp trend.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many homes are in Waterbrooke Phase 3?
The Florida DOR 2025 assessment roll shows 250 homes plus 1 vacant residential lots in Waterbrooke Phase 3 (public records).
What share of Waterbrooke Phase 3 is owner-occupied?
64% of Waterbrooke Phase 3 parcels carry a homestead exemption on the 2025 Florida DOR roll, the owner-occupancy proxy in public records.
When were the homes in Waterbrooke Phase 3 built?
Homes in Waterbrooke Phase 3 were built between 2019 and 2024, with a median year built of 2022 (FL DOR 2025 roll).
Do cash buyers compete in Waterbrooke Phase 3?
Cash buyers took 0% of Waterbrooke Phase 3 sales in the 12 months ending June 2025 (0 of 7 closings, Stellar MLS).
